Bent Valves, Low compression?
I misshifted bad earlier in the day. If I do indeed have bent valves, will my compression test read low, or is there a possibility of it reading normal. Thanks
yeah, it can not show if it leaks slowly, on the compression tester you have a check valve so air cant come back into the cyl.; so if pressure builds up and then it leaks it wont show.
If the idle is fine, check valve clearances;; if for example 2 are off then you know

you can test if you have bent valves with compression test. if somehow there is low compression the you have bent valve, hg, or rings as the culprit. with bent vavlves comprsion will hit a certain point and remain there evn if you turn the engine over a million times. leakdown will tell you exactly where the leak is. but comprssion will help out too.
